Vultures can smell death up to a mile away.

Vultures know when something is dying or when something is dead through smell since vultures can smell death or dead animals from at least a mile away as vultures have a very good sense of smell.

Turkey Vultures use their sense of smell to find carrion.

Other vultures, like the Black Vulture, rely upon their vision to find food, often locating carrion by watching where other vultures go.

The most widespread vulture in North America, the turkey vulture is locally called “buzzard” in many areas.

A turkey vulture standing on the ground can, at a distance, resemble a wild turkey.

It is unique among our vultures in that it finds carrion by smell as well as by sight.

The sound that a Black Vulture makes is a raspy, drawn-out hissing sound while feeding and fighting, along with grunting noises that can sound like hungry pigs or dogs barking in the distance.

Although Black Vultures and other Vultures are silent most of the time.

A vulture is a bird of prey that scavenges on carrion.

There are 23 extant species of vulture.

Old World vultures include 16 living species native to Europe, Africa, and Asia; New World vultures are restricted to North and South America and consist of seven identified species, all belonging to the Cathartidae family.

Unlike the turkey vulture, black vultures are bolder and may prey on living animals from calves, lambs, piglets, and other small critters.

Black vultures are highly sociable with humans and they are very intelligent.

Many of the typical abatement techniques to scare off unwanted birds do not work with black vultures because they are smart enough to know that they will not be harmed by bright lights, noises, shining objects and so on.
